Regional Weather Summary
National Weather Service Glasgow MT
318 PM MDT Wed Sep 25 2024

This is the regional weather summary for the eastern two-thirds
of Montana, southern Saskatchewan, and western North Dakota.

The ridge of high pressure that brought dry and well above normal
temperatures to the region the past several days will begin to
shift east overnight. This will allow a cold front to sweep
through the area on Thursday.

Tonight will remain partly cloudy and mild, with lows in the 50s.
Thursday will be windy and cooler, with highs ranging from the
upper 60s and lower 70s in central Montana, to the upper 70s and
lower 80s in the east. Winds are expected to gust from 30 to 35
mph in the afternoon, before subsiding around sunset.

Thursday night will be partly cloudy with overnight lows mainly
in the 40s, with temperatures climbing back into the 80s Friday.
